What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$24,228 more than it took in. Revenue $724,369 · expenses $748,597 · reserve months 101.9
Tax year 2022 — took in $1,697,037 more than it spent. Revenue $2,661,073 · expenses $964,036 · reserve months 79.4
Tax year 2021 — took in $1,003,275 more than it spent. Revenue $1,827,355 · expenses $824,080 · reserve months 13.7
Tax year 2020 — took in $236,160 more than it spent. Revenue $875,934 · expenses $639,774 · reserve months 9.1
Tax year 2019 — spent $206,225 more than it took in. Revenue $639,795 · expenses $846,020 · reserve months 2.7
Tax year 2018 — took in $276,578 more than it spent. Revenue $1,071,674 · expenses $795,096 · reserve months 6.0
Tax year 2017 — took in $209,724 more than it spent. Revenue $879,636 · expenses $669,912 · reserve months 2.5
Tax year 2016 — spent $29,564 more than it took in. Revenue $336,872 · expenses $366,436 · reserve months 0.5
Tax year 2015 — spent $25,055 more than it took in. Revenue $185,555 · expenses $210,610 · reserve months 3.6
Tax year 2014 — took in $57,688 more than it spent. Revenue $191,071 · expenses $133,383 · reserve months 7.9
